Trade Act 2002

Certain Individuals who, under limited circumstances, become eligible to take advantage of trade adjustment assistance pursuant to the Trade Act may receive a second 60-day COBRA election period. If you are receiving trade adjustment assistance or if you are eligible for trade adjustment assistance, please contact the Benefits Office for more information.

Additional Continuation Coverage Information

Your COBRA rights are subject to change. Coverage will be provided only as required by law. This notice is only a general summary of the law, federal and state continuation coverage law and the applicable plan provisions will control over this summary in the event of a conflict. If the law changes, your rights will change accordingly.

For more information about your rights under ERISA, including COBRA, the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A), and other laws affecting group health plans, contact the nearest Regional or District Office of the U.S. Department of Labor’s Employee Benefits Security Administration (EBSA) in your area or visit www.dol.gov/ebsa. (Addresses and phone numbers of Regional and District EBSA Offices are available through EBSA’s Web site.)

To protect your family’s rights, you should keep the Benefits Office informed of any changes in the addresses of family members. You should also keep a copy, for your records, of any notices you send to the Benefits Office.
